Bluestone National Park Resort reopens its gates to staying guests from today.

Bluestone's family-friendly, luxury resort's self-catering lodges have undergone an enhanced cleaning regime and onsite activities and facilities have also been fully reviewed.

New features too, like in-lodge food delivery, are being introduced to welcome back the first guests.

Bluestone has assessed and reviewed every area of the resort in readiness for re-opening, along with introducing enhanced staff training, cleaning measures and social distancing procedures and has launched its Guest Charter, setting out a commitment to work to protect guests, while, at the same time, asking guests to assist too.
